Key Responsibilities – What You’ll Do Every Day

  • Enter, verify, and update data across arenaflex’s internal systems, ensuring every record meets our high‑quality standards.
  • Perform high‑volume data entry tasks with speed and accuracy, consistently meeting or exceeding daily productivity targets.
  • Conduct routine quality‑control checks to identify and correct discrepancies, safeguarding the integrity of critical business information.
  • Collaborate virtually with cross‑functional teams—including inventory, finance, and customer service—to support project milestones and deliverables.
  • Maintain clear and timely communication with supervisors, providing status updates, flagging potential issues, and suggesting process improvements.
  • Utilize Microsoft Office tools—especially Excel and Word—to organize, format, and present data in a clear, actionable manner.
  • Adhere to data‑security protocols, ensuring confidential information is handled responsibly and in compliance with company policies.
  • Continuously seek opportunities to streamline workflows, reduce manual effort, and enhance overall efficiency.

Essential Qualifications – What We’re Looking For

  • Education: High school diploma or equivalent; additional coursework in business, information systems, or related fields is a plus.
  • Attention to Detail: Demonstrated ability to spot errors, maintain consistency, and uphold data integrity.
  • Typing Proficiency: Minimum typing speed of 45 words per minute with a high degree of accuracy.
  • Technical Skills: Comfortable navigating Microsoft Office Suite, especially Excel (basic formulas, sorting, filtering) and Word.
  • Self‑Management: Proven ability to work independently, prioritize tasks, and meet deadlines without direct supervision.
  • Communication: Strong written and verbal communication skills for effective collaboration in a remote environment.
  • Workspace Requirements: Reliable high‑speed internet connection and a quiet, distraction‑free home office.
